Event adjudication and data monitoring in an intensive care unit observational study of thromboprophylaxis
Journal of Critical Care, 06/09/09
Cook D et al. - Adjudication of whether an outcome can be attributed to an intervention in an open-label, uncontrolled observational study gives a potentially misleading impression of research oversight without methodological face validity. In this study, the EAC recommended modification of the adjudication process, and the DMC recommended continuing enrolment to achieve the target sample size.
